Sustainable development is now the main goal in efforts to achieve community prosperity, maintain environmental sustainability, and promote inclusive economic growth. Green economy, which emphasizes economic growth that does not harm the environment and strengthens social sustainability, is a strategic basis for developing tourist villages. This journal is a review of a selection of journals that are case studies in this review. A literature search was carried out using the Google Scholars online database. The findings of this research are that the researcher concludes, Although many tourist villages have adopted the Green Economy concept as the main basis for their development, the reality presents a series of challenges that need to be overcome. Limited resources, both in terms of finance and infrastructure, are a real obstacle that hinders the ability of tourist villages to fully realize their Green Economy potential. Community resistance to change is also a serious challenge. Increasing understanding of the Green Economy concept also needs to be the main focus in efforts to overcome this obstacle. Educational programs, training and information campaigns can help make people aware of the economic, social and environmental benefits of implementing a Green Economy. Leading to better understanding can reduce resistance and encourage people to play an active role in the sustainability economy. Tourism villages can achieve a more effective and sustainable transformation. Close cooperation between government, society and the private sector is needed to create an environment that supports positive change.
